**Ticket #GH-4412: Expired creds blocking drift calibration**

Hey — welcome aboard! Quick one for you. The Fernhaven greenhouse controller has been logging sensor drift on the humidity probes in bays 3 and 5, but the nightly calibration job can't push corrections because its credential expired over the weekend. The drift itself is normal seasonal stuff; the blocker is purely auth. I've minted a fresh credential for the calibration service, so just drop it into the controller's config. Use the key below.

gateway credential: kto23_LX9A4ys6i4nzHtpOLNLodKK

**Onboarding: The Quiet Room (Level 9)**

Grayfenn Labs keeps a quiet room on the top floor, next to the north stairwell, for focused work and calls home. No bookings needed — first come, first served, two-hour limit. Phones on silent, no meetings. The room is kept locked outside 08:00–18:00 to prevent overnight use. To get in during off-hours, enter the door code at the keypad:

turnstile pass: bdg-TXR-4

## Further Reading

Compaction in Fennelmq runs per-partition and can lag after large retention changes. Before cutting a release, confirm the compactor backlog is near zero; shipping with a backlog inflates startup times. Tuning knobs, backlog dashboards, and the rollback procedure are all documented on the internal page below.

operations page: https://jenkins.zemvarcloud.local/job/merge_requests/repo/build/73930b4b30f0a8ed